Tánaiste welcomes the result of the GRA ballot

Tánaiste Frances Fitzgerald has welcomed the outcome of the ballot of members of the Garda Representative Association on the recommendation of the Labour Court.

Speaking this evening, the Tánaiste said:

No-one, be it the Government, Gardaí themselves or the public, wanted to see industrial action that would have damaged the hard-earned reputation of An Garda Síochána.

The independent recommendation of the Labour Court sought to address the concerns that have been articulated by the representative bodies in relation to their pay and conditions, the pay and conditions of new recruits, and their access to the statutory dispute resolution bodies.

The outcome is one which is in the best interests of An Garda Síochána and the community they serve so well.

My Department and I now look forward to working with the GRA towards progressing access to the statutory resolution bodies and their engagement with the Public Service Pay Commission.

I want to thank all involved in the negotiations that resulted in today’s outcome.
